Biblical Meaning of Dreaming About Cats Every Night

In biblical interpretation, dreams are sometimes used to reveal, warn, guide, or expose what is hidden. However, interpretation requires humility and discernment. If you keep seeing cats every night, the dream may point to one or more themes:

  • Discernment: Cats are observant and alert, which may symbolize the need to watch carefully and test what is happening around you.
  • Hidden motives: A cat moving quietly or appearing suddenly may reflect concerns about secrecy, deception, or unclear intentions.
  • Independence: Cats often represent self-reliance, personal boundaries, or emotional distance.
  • Spiritual sensitivity: Repeated dreams may encourage prayer, self-examination, and greater awareness of your spiritual environment.
  • Unresolved emotions: Dreaming of cats every night can also reflect anxiety, curiosity, fear, affection, or a relationship dynamic that needs attention.

Cats Every Night Dream Interpretation: Key Details to Notice

A balanced cats every night dream interpretation should look at the details instead of assuming one fixed meaning. Ask yourself what the cat was doing and how you felt in the dream.

If the Cat Is Calm or Friendly

A peaceful cat may suggest comfort, intuition, emotional independence, or a need to protect your personal space. Biblically, this can be a reminder to walk in wisdom, stay alert, and maintain healthy boundaries without becoming fearful.

If the Cat Is Aggressive

An aggressive cat may symbolize conflict, spiritual uneasiness, hidden tension, or a person or situation that feels unpredictable. It may be wise to pray for clarity and examine whether there is unresolved conflict in your waking life.

How to Respond Biblically

If you are dreaming about cats every night, respond with prayer, wisdom, and calm reflection rather than fear. Write the dreams down, notice repeated patterns, and compare them with what is happening in your life. If the dream causes distress, pray for peace and clarity, and consider speaking with a trusted spiritual mentor or counselor.

The most helpful approach is not to treat every cat dream as a direct message from God, but to ask what the dream may be revealing about your heart, your relationships, or your need for discernment.
